Fully equipped, romantic cabin for 2 in the Blue Ridge Mountains
Pines has a carpeted bedroom with a queen sized bed, and adjacent dressing room and large bath with 2 person air jetted tub and separate shower. All towels, linens, and amenities are provided. The bedroom also has a ceiling fan , and has an alarm clock. The living room/dining area has hardwood floors, and a through the wall gas fireplace – through from the living room into the bedroom. There a lots of books, games and cards, and a stereo unit with CD’s to enjoy. There is no TV or telephone, and cell service is very spotty. The cabin is provided with central air conditioning and heat. The kitchen is fully equipped with range, refrigerator/freezer, microwave, coffee maker, toaster, blender, electric mixer, and all utensils need to prepare meals, you just need to bring your food. Granite counter tops in kitchen. There is an open deck, with table and chairs and a BBQ grill, as well as a covered porch with rocking chairs and ceiling fan. There is also an outdoor fire pit for outside fires; wood is provided. Adults only, no pets. Please, no smoking in the cabin – thank you.

Chuck was an outstanding host—prompt in replying, clear with directions, and thoughtful in checking in to be sure all was well (in a genuine, non-intrusive way). The cabin was exactly as described, yet even more delightful in person thanks to so many special touches.We loved the thoughtful amenities: cozy robes, an immaculately clean whirlpool tub for two, bath salts and herbs made on the farm, and even toiletries like makeup remover cloths and toothbrushes if needed. With no Wi-Fi or TV, the cabin’s charm really shined—stocked with board games (we played Trivial Pursuit!), a wonderfully eclectic library, and a CD player. We even listened to a CD of the concert that was our very first date—14 years to the day!What impressed us most, though, were the personal touches: fresh flowers in a vase on the coffee table, mints on the bed, and a handwritten note waiting when we arrived. These details made us feel genuinely welcome and cared for.As the quote says, “Into the forest I go to lose my mind and find my soul.” This cabin was exactly that kind of restorative retreat.
